Output e383ab594d6ff522b422b610414988ca2a933d61a2ce99aa22d981d81ff0d951:26

value
37331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be21cff864edc3efdad03050dac92fa49906ea6d OP_EQUAL
address
3K2LpKMAhaEHkpFc5qZjdcnApDSymE1xSP
transaction
e383ab594d6ff522b422b610414988ca2a933d61a2ce99aa22d981d81ff0d951
spent
true